Problem Note 14035: Error in Campaign Studio when executing a communication/export that
includes a character seed field containing a numeric value
| Type: | Problem Note |
| Priority: | high |
| Date Modified: | 2005-03-10 14:55:16 |
| Date Created: | 2004-12-17 10:06:39 |
An unexpected error in Campaign Studio can occur under the following
circumstances:
1. Comprising a seed list from SAS Management Console and one of
the columns in the seed list is defined in the master seeds template as
a character column. Also, although defined as character, the column is
populated with a numeric value, e.g. 123456.
2. Subsequently creating a campaign and communication, and in the
communications properties specifying that the communication should use
the seed list previously created.
3. When the communication is executed, the following error may appear:
com.sas.analytics.crm.error.client.ApplicationException: Stored process
results not ok
at
com.sas.analytics.crm.custdata.datapattern.MAQuery.execute(MAQuery.java:
386)
at
com.sas.analytics.crm.flow.ejb.MACommunicationNode.run(MACommunicationNo
de.java:
265)
at
com.sas.analytics.crm.flow.ejb.FlowBean.executeNode(FlowBean.java:1514)
at
com.sas.analytics.crm.flow.ejb.FlowBean.executeCommunication(FlowBean.ja
va:3072)
at
com.sas.analytics.crm.flow.ejb.FlowBean.executeCommunicationSync(FlowBea
n.java:3
030)
at
com.sas.analytics.crm.flow.ejb.FlowBean_8pxhvo_EOImpl.executeCommunicati
onSync(F
lowBean_8pxhvo_EOImpl.java:3658)
at
com.sas.analytics.crm.cm.ejb.CampaignBean.executeCommunication(CampaignB
ean.java
:602)
at
com.sas.analytics.crm.cm.ejb.CampaignBean_xzpatc_EOImpl.executeCommunica
tion(Cam
paignBean_xzpatc_EOImpl.java:208)
at
com.sas.analytics.crm.cm.ejb.CampaignBean_xzpatc_EOImpl_WLSkel.invoke(Un
known
Source)
at
weblogic.rmi.internal.activation.ActivatableServerRef.invoke(Activatable
ServerRe
f.java:87)
at
weblogic.rmi.internal.BasicServerRef$1.run(BasicServerRef.java:420)
at
we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Su
bject.ja
va:353)
at
weblogic.security.service.SecurityManager.runAs(SecurityManager.java:144
)
at
weblogic.rmi.internal.BasicServerRef.handleRequest(BasicServerRef.java:4
15)
at
weblogic.rmi.internal.BasicExecuteRequest.execute(BasicExecuteRequest.ja
va:30)
at weblogic.kernel.ExecuteThread.execute(ExecuteThread.java:197)
at weblogic.kernel.ExecuteThread.run(ExecuteThread.java:170)
The Stored Process log shows the following error:
ERROR: Variable <Variable Name> has been defined as both character and
numeric.
A fix for this issue is available at:
http://www.sas.com/techsup/download/hotfix/ma42.html#014035
Operating System and Release Information
| Product Family | Product | System | Reported Release | Fixed Release |
| SAS System | SAS Campaign Studio | Microsoft Windows XP Professional | 4.2 | |
| Microsoft Windows Server 2003 Standard Edition | 4.2 | |
| Microsoft Windows 2000 Professional | 4.2 | |
| Microsoft Windows 2000 Server | 4.2 | |
| Microsoft Windows Server 2003 Datacenter Edition | 4.2 | |
| Microsoft Windows Server 2003 Enterprise Edition | 4.2 | |
| Microsoft Windows 2000 Datacenter Server | 4.2 | |
| Microsoft Windows 2000 Advanced Server | 4.2 | |